Jazmine Johnson and La Lavande

Café Acoustic Session

26 October 2022 - 7.30pm

We're excited to be joined by the talented due Jazmine Johnson and La Lavande – performing both separately and together for a special acoustic evening.

 

Jazmine Johnson is a 23-year-old songstress from Liverpool who started singing at the tender age of 11. She first honed her skills at a summer workshop where she was able to perform regularly with a band at the Cavern Club. The fire that was ignited from this had encouraged her to start playing the guitar and has been writing ever since.  She is influenced by the likes of Amy Winehouse, Yebba and Allen Stone. She fuses rhythmical, soulful melodies with raw lyrics that display honesty and vulnerability. Last year she released her debut single, If I Ever, and has had great support from the likes of BBC Introducing, LIMF and more.  After a few years of working on her sound, she has just started to write her debut EP in where she speaks about the life lessons and the real world experiences that she has had. 

 

Through her atmospheric and captivating performances, La Lavande draws you into a world full of complex characters and dark stories. The Liverpool-based singer is a storyteller as much a songwriter whose love of poetry, lyricists, art and film combine with delicate musicality to create a sound that’s utterly enchanting. Since winning the Judges’ Award in the Liverpool Acoustic Songwriting Competition in 2017, La Lavande joined the Levi’s music project in collaboration with Warner Music and Loyle Carner. She then joined the most recent cohort of the Merseyrail Soundstation programme curated by music magazine Bido Lito! and most recently the Study the WRD programe through the prestigious Ivors Academy. Her work has been heard with radio play from the likes of BBC Introducing, Amazing Radio, and Mersey Radio.
